what is mobile responsive test
Importancia de las pruebas de respuesta móvil:
En el mundo mecanizado de hoy, los sitios web no solo se ven en una computadora portátil o de escritorio, sino también en una tableta y un teléfono inteligente.
Atrás quedaron los días en que solíamos sentarnos frente a nuestras computadoras de escritorio o portátiles para hacer compras, navegar por Internet o enviar correos electrónicos. Ahora es la era de los dispositivos móviles y las personas acceden a Internet mientras caminan por las calles, se sientan en un parque y en cualquier lugar que deseen según su comodidad.
Si observa una computadora de escritorio, una computadora portátil, una tableta y un teléfono inteligente, no solo su sistema operativo, CPU, etc., difieren, sino también los tamaños de pantalla.
Por lo tanto, para una empresa que no solo confía en una aplicación sino también en un sitio web, es muy importante que el sitio web encaje bien en estos diferentes tamaños. A sus clientes o usuarios no les gustará si tienen que ajustar sus teléfonos para ver mejor el contenido de su sitio web.
Todos usamos sitios web de Amazon, Agoda y ZDNet, etc., casi a diario. Imagínese lo tedioso que sería si tuviera que acceder a la siguiente página o una imagen, pero el enlace no encaja en la pantalla o es demasiado pequeño para hacer clic en él. Tales cosas resultan en la pérdida del interés del usuario.
Aquí es donde entra en juego el comportamiento receptivo o compatible con dispositivos móviles.
El diseño web receptivo o amigable está fundamentalmente relacionado con los sitios web. El diseño web móvil adaptable es un enfoque seguido en el desarrollo del sitio web para brindar a los usuarios una experiencia de visualización decente en cualquier dispositivo que estén viendo.
Google da prioridad a los sitios optimizados para dispositivos móviles en sus resultados de búsqueda y, por lo tanto, es importante diseñar su sitio web teniendo esto en cuenta.
Primero entendamos qué es este 'diseño web adaptable para dispositivos móviles'.
Lo que vas a aprender:
- Significado de capacidad de respuesta móvil o diseño amigable
- Herramienta recomendada
- Conclusión
Significado de capacidad de respuesta móvil o diseño amigable
El diseño web receptivo también se conoce como RWD y es un enfoque para diseñar un sitio web para que las páginas web se construyan con diferentes dispositivos y sus tamaños de pantalla.
Tiene tres principios de desarrollo que incluyen:
- Rejillas fluidas: Este enfoque se basa en el porcentaje y no en el enfoque histórico basado en píxeles.
- Media Queries : Se utiliza para aplicar diferentes estilos según el tamaño de la pantalla del dispositivo.
- Imágenes y medios flexibles : Esto ayuda a mostrar las imágenes y los medios de manera diferente en diferentes tamaños mediante el uso de escalado o CSS.
Con el enfoque de desarrollo, la prueba de sitios web receptivos también es importante.
Los sitios web optimizados para dispositivos móviles deben brindar la misma experiencia a los usuarios en un dispositivo móvil que en una computadora portátil o de escritorio. Debe probarse para diferentes navegadores, diferentes tamaños de pantalla, modos: horizontal o vertical, etc.
Herramienta recomendada
# 1) Navegador LambdaTest LT
Un navegador orientado a desarrolladores que proporciona a los usuarios un espacio de trabajo de desarrollo para probar la capacidad de respuesta de su sitio web en una variedad de ventanas gráficas de dispositivos. Desarrollado con el objetivo de reducir el tiempo necesario para las pruebas de respuesta, está diseñado para simplificar las tareas de prueba diarias de los probadores y desarrolladores web.
Características principales:
- Pruebe instantáneamente en diferentes ventanas gráficas de dispositivos.
- Crea tu propio dispositivo personalizado.
- Depurar en diferentes ventanas gráficas en paralelo.
- Las pruebas de sitios web locales nunca han sido tan fáciles.
- Herramientas de desarrollo integradas para una depuración más rápida.
- Toma capturas de pantalla y videos y compártelos con tu equipo.
Pruebas de respuesta móvil y sus desafíos
La incorporación de un diseño web receptivo no pone fin a la historia; es igualmente importante probar su implementación para asegurarse de que el sitio web se muestre como se esperaba en todos los dispositivos.
El contenido, los videos, las imágenes, los enlaces, etc., deben probarse para determinar su apariencia antes de lanzar el sitio web. No solo en todos los dispositivos, sino que también se deben realizar pruebas en diferentes navegadores y sistemas operativos.
¿Qué es un buen descargador de música gratuito?
Por ejemplo , un sitio web puede verse un poco diferente en Android en comparación con iOS o Windows.
(imagen fuente)
Pero también hay grandes desafíos que enfrenta el QA para probar la capacidad de respuesta. El mayor desafío son las combinaciones de tamaños de pantalla, las versiones del sistema operativo, los modos del teléfono, los navegadores y sus resoluciones. De ahí que sea difícil decidir la estrategia. Los otros desafíos incluyen el período de prueba, las herramientas, la priorización de las pruebas, etc.
A continuación, se muestran algunos consejos para decidir cómo realizar la prueba:
# 1) banco de pruebas
Crear matrices para las diferentes combinaciones de tamaños de teléfonos, navegadores, sistemas operativos y versiones es una tarea muy tediosa y complicada. Por lo tanto, como garantía de calidad, sugeriría tomar aportes del BA y del propietario o gerente del producto.
Porque considerando las complicaciones del banco de pruebas, es recomendable dejarles decidir las versiones, tamaños, etc. que deben probarse. Puede suceder que dedique mucho tiempo a investigar y diseñar estrategias para los bancos de pruebas que pueden no ser aprobados por su gerente o maestro de SCRUM. Los sitios web son accesibles desde computadoras de escritorio, teléfonos, etc.
Por lo tanto, el banco de pruebas debe incluir navegadores cuyas versiones sean comunes para todos estos dispositivos, de esa manera se evitarán las complicaciones de la variación de la versión y se podrá probar la misma versión en todos.
# 2) Asignación de tiempo
Debe discutir y finalizar cuánto tiempo se requiere para las pruebas y cuánto se asignará, ya que la prueba de sitios web receptivos requiere mucho tiempo.
En base a esto, tendrá que preparar el plan de cómo y qué probar. Asegúrese de que se asigne tiempo suficiente para las pruebas, de modo que se pruebe una serie de combinaciones importantes de bancos de pruebas.
# 3) Dispositivos y emuladores reales
Para probar tantas combinaciones, no es posible comprar todos los dispositivos reales, por lo que se pueden usar emuladores y simuladores.
Según mi experiencia, lo más importante son las versiones, tamaños, etc. y debe probarse en dispositivos reales, pero las versiones y tamaños de teléfonos que están algo desactualizados se pueden probar en emuladores y simuladores.
# 4) Manual o Automatización
Las pruebas se pueden realizar utilizando un enfoque tanto manual como automático. A veces, las herramientas no pueden ver lo que puede ver un ojo, por lo que en ocasiones también es necesario realizar pruebas manuales. Los esfuerzos se pueden dividir en 65% de automatización y 35% de esfuerzos manuales o viceversa.
Por ejemplo ,una herramienta para hacer clic en un enlace pequeño es muy diferente a hacer clic con los dedos o alejar manualmente una página web en lugar de una herramienta para alejar la página.
# 5) Priorizar las pruebas
Las pruebas deben priorizarse correctamente porque hay mucho que probar y no todo se puede probar. Por lo tanto, todo el equipo debe estar de acuerdo con el plan de pruebas y su prioridad. La prioridad de las pruebas se debe comunicar al BA y al propietario del producto con suficiente antelación para que, si tienen alguna sugerencia, también puedan examinarse.
Las combinaciones de sistemas operativos, navegadores y tamaños de pantalla de uso común deben probarse a fondo y con prioridad. . Según mi experiencia, se debe realizar una ronda completa de pruebas en el último sistema operativo móvil, pero después de que todos los problemas se solucionen y verifiquen porque no todos usan el último sistema operativo móvil.
Importancia de probar la capacidad de respuesta de un sitio web
El contenido de un sitio web es lo que promueve la empresa y si el contenido no es atractivo para los clientes, la empresa no puede prosperar bien. Por lo tanto, el desarrollo de un sitio web receptivo no termina la historia, también debe ser revisado y verificado.
Las pruebas juegan un papel vital para asegurar que estamos brindando una aplicación de calidad, robusta y fácil de usar a nuestros clientes. Lo mismo ocurre con un sitio web adaptable a dispositivos móviles.
A continuación se presentan algunos factores que denotan la importancia de probar un sitio web con capacidad de respuesta móvil:
# 1) Una gran cantidad de dispositivos, sistemas operativos y navegadores: La verificación del contenido debe realizarse para dispositivos móviles de diferentes tamaños de pantalla, sistemas operativos y navegadores. No significa que si el contenido es perfecto, también será perfecto para otros.
# 2) Robustez: El tiempo que tarda un sitio web en cargar el contenido debe ser el mismo en las distintas plataformas y no debe ser lento ni agotado en ningún dispositivo o navegador 'compatible'. Por lo tanto, probar el rendimiento del sitio web es importante para los sitios web con capacidad de respuesta móvil.
# 3) Navegación: Es un defecto muy común que se encuentra al probar sitios web o aplicaciones móviles que las páginas no se cargan como se esperaba cuando se navega entre los diferentes enlaces del sitio web. A veces, sucede que faltan los enlaces o las imágenes no se cargan o se agota el tiempo de espera mientras se juega con la navegación.
# 4) Variedad de imágenes y videos: Se requiere una prueba adecuada para verificar si todos los tipos de imágenes y videos se muestran como se espera en diferentes teléfonos, navegadores, etc.
A veces, algunos videos se reproducen bien en Android, pero ni siquiera se cargan en iOS o algunas imágenes aparecen rotas en algunas versiones de un sistema operativo móvil mientras que son perfectas en otras.
Estos problemas pueden dar una muy mala impresión si no se realizan las pruebas. Por lo tanto, probar sitios web con capacidad de respuesta móvil es importante junto con otras pruebas como funcional, seguridad, etc.
Pocos casos de prueba de muestra para probar la capacidad de respuesta móvil
Por lo general, los probadores comienzan a probar cambiando el tamaño de las ventanas de los móviles, navegadores, tabletas, computadoras portátiles, etc., pero hay mucho más que probar.
A continuación se muestran algunos casos de prueba de ejemplo que se pueden cubrir mientras se prueba un sitio web con capacidad de respuesta móvil; asegúrese de que los casos de prueba se prueben para todas las matrices del banco de pruebas:
- Verifique si el contenido se ajusta a la pantalla y no está recortado ni distorsionado.
- Verifique si los videos se están cargando y no tienen enlaces rotos.
- Verifique si el color del texto, la fuente, etc., siguen siendo los mismos.
- Verifique si el alejamiento no distorsiona el contenido, las imágenes y los videos de la página web.
- Verifique si un desplazamiento rápido no distorsiona el contenido.
- Verifique si los enlaces funcionan bien y si llevan al usuario a la página correspondiente.
- Verifique si la página web no está agotando el tiempo de espera o si tarda demasiado en cargarse.
- Verifique si el cambio de modo horizontal a vertical o viceversa ajusta el contenido en consecuencia.
- Verifique si las imágenes de diferentes tipos como .jpg, .png, .gif, etc. se muestran como se esperaba.
- Verifique si se puede hacer clic en los enlaces cuando se hace zoom en teléfonos de pantalla pequeña.
- Verifique si navegar entre páginas web no distorsiona el contenido, etc.
Herramientas de prueba receptivas móviles
Hay varias herramientas disponibles para probar la capacidad de respuesta de un móvil, tanto gratuitas como de pago.
Según mi experiencia, para este tipo de prueba en particular, es mejor utilizar una herramienta que se pueda utilizar para una variedad de teléfonos, sus sistemas operativos, navegadores, etc. No es factible utilizar diferentes herramientas para diferentes dispositivos, navegadores etc.
Por lo tanto, al elegir una herramienta, elija la que pueda cubrir el máximo del banco de pruebas.
Herramientas de prueba receptivas móviles de código abierto adicionales:
#1) Websiteresponsivetest.com: Esta herramienta es compatible con todos los principales navegadores web y proporciona una vista previa de cómo se verá el sitio web real. Para obtener los resultados de la capacidad de respuesta de un sitio web, debemos ingresar la URL de nuestro sitio web.
# 2) Screenfly: También es una herramienta de prueba de respuesta móvil y se puede utilizar para realizar pruebas en la pestaña Galaxy, iPad, etc. Detecta automáticamente el sitio móvil del sitio web y lo lleva al mismo.
# 3) Resizer de VeiwPort: Es una herramienta configurable y se puede utilizar para personalizar el tamaño de pantalla de un navegador.
#4) Responsinator: Esto viene como una versión paga también donde puede comprar el subdominio para su prueba. Al proporcionar la URL del sitio web, esta herramienta muestra cómo se verá el sitio web.
Conclusión
Las pruebas de respuesta móvil son muy importantes para garantizar que todos los usuarios obtengan una experiencia de visualización óptima en sus dispositivos, tal vez una computadora portátil, una computadora de escritorio, una tableta o un teléfono inteligente.
Como se discutió anteriormente, solo si el contenido parece bueno para un usuario, estará interesado en ir más allá, por lo tanto, junto con los otros tipos de pruebas de funcionalidad, seguridad, estrés, etc., las pruebas de respuesta también son muy importantes y no deben tomarse a la ligera.
Las pruebas de respuesta móvil son simples, pero los bancos de pruebas plantean la mayor complejidad y desafío. Por lo tanto, usted, como QA, debe tratar con inteligencia.
En nuestro próximo artículo, discutiremos más sobre Proveedores de servicios de prueba de aplicaciones móviles basados en la nube .
Lectura recomendada
- Mejores herramientas de prueba de software 2021 (Herramientas de automatización de pruebas de control de calidad)
- ¿Por qué las pruebas móviles son difíciles?
- Las 10 mejores herramientas de prueba de seguridad de aplicaciones móviles en 2021
- Cómo conseguir un trabajo de prueba móvil rápidamente - Guía profesional de pruebas móviles (Parte 1)
- 5 desafíos y soluciones de pruebas móviles
- Las 15 mejores herramientas de prueba móviles en 2021 para Android e iOS
- Pruebas de aplicaciones móviles basadas en la nube: descripción general completa
- Más de 40 preguntas y respuestas de entrevistas de pruebas móviles más comunes con un curriculum vitae de prueba móvil de muestra